The AMC V8s had all the torque, but not so much the efficiency. OTOH, parts are cheap, because it used the ECU/carb/distributor/alternator/starter and solenoid/AC compressor/brakes from a Ford pickup, the Mopar 727 transmission, and Dana 44 axles. Pretty much only the longblock, frame, and body were built by AMC, everything else was overruns from other marques, depending on year (in the '70s they had GM TH400 transmissions, in the '60s Buick engines, etc.).
